Shabeen (unlicensed tavern) at Cape Flats
I saw another side of the "New South Africa" on a tour of the
black and colored townships outside of Cape Town. This is the
entrance to a shabeen, an unlicensed tavern offering home brew beer.
Proprietor and customer of Shabeen
The women to the right is the proprietor. She makes food as well
for the customers, and prepares the home brew which is passed around
from man to man to drink communally. I tried some - it wasn't bad.
